ALL THE BOYS LOVE MANDY LANE
Director: Jonathan Levine
Cast: Amber Heard, Anson Mount, Edwin Hodge, Melissa Price, Michael Welch, Whitney Able
Synopsis: Mandy Lane (Amber Heard) is an unattainable object of adolescent lust for all in her high school. A shy teen, Mandy is forced to entertain irritating advances while attending a weekend excursion with her classmates. She thinks these pathetic ‘come-ons’ will be the worst of it, but she is horrifyingly mistaken. As her school mates are killed off one-by-one, it becomes clear that a secret admirer is harbouring some terrifying ulterior motives. A smart, sexy and scary horror thriller.
MY BLUEBERRY NIGHTS
Director: Wong Kar Wai
Cast: David Strathairn, Jude Law, Natalie Portman, Norah Jones, Rachel Weisz
Synopsis: In Wong Kar Wai's debut English language feature, the internationally acclaimed director takes his audience on a dramatic journey across the distance between heartbreak and a new beginning.
After a rough break-up, Elizabeth (played by songstress Norah Jones in her screen debut) sets out on a journey across America, leaving behind a life of memories, a dream and a soulful new friend; a café owner (Jude Law)—all while in search of something to mend her broken heart. Waitressing her way through the country, Elizabeth befriends others whose yearnings are greater than hers, including a troubled cop (David Strathairn) and his estranged wife (Rachel Weisz) and a down-on-her luck gambler (Natalie Portman) with a score to settle.
Through these individuals, Elizabeth witnesses the true depths of loneliness and emptiness, and begins to understand that her own journey is part of a greater exploration within herself.
DIARY OF THE DEAD
Director: George A. Romero
Cast: George Buza, Joshua Close, Laura DeCarteret, Matt Birman, Nick Alachiotis
Synopsis: A group of young film students run into real-life zombies while filming a horror movie of their own.
